The legal team for a Christian website designer whom Colorado wants to compel to create sites that celebrate same-sex marriage is “very hopeful” that the Supreme Court will rule in their client’s favor.

The case is of interest to many because the Supreme Court has become increasingly protective of religious freedoms in recent years as former President Donald Trump appointed three conservative justices, giving the court a 6-3 conservative majority. Those on the left say the court’s embrace of religious freedoms is coming at the expense of LGBT rights.

The Supreme Court is scheduled to hear oral arguments in the First Amendment religious freedom case on Dec. 5. The case is 303 Creative LLC v. Elenis, court file 21-476. The respondent, Aubrey Elenis, is being sued in her official capacity as Director of the Colorado Civil Rights Division.
